如何使用GitHub清华镜像来加速你的开发

在现代软件开发中,GitHub作为一个开放的代码托管平台,已经成为了开发者的重要工具。然而,由于网络环境的限制,很多用户在使用GitHub时常常面临下载速度慢的问题。为了提升用户体验,清华大学提供了一个GitHub的镜像服务,本文将详细介绍如何使用GitHub清华镜像来加速你的开发。

什么是GitHub清华镜像?

GitHub清华镜像是由清华大学开源软件镜像站点提供的GitHub仓库的镜像服务。通过该镜像服务,用户可以更快地访问和下载GitHub上的项目文件,特别是在中国地区,清华镜像可以显著减少网络延迟,提高下载速度。

为什么使用GitHub清华镜像?

使用GitHub清华镜像的主要优势包括:

  • 提高下载速度:通过使用清华镜像,用户可以在中国大陆以更快的速度下载项目文件。
  • 降低网络问题:避免因国际网络波动导致的下载失败或超时。
  • 访问更多资源:清华镜像不仅支持GitHub,还包含多个开源软件的镜像资源,方便用户获取各种工具和库。

如何使用GitHub清华镜像?

使用GitHub清华镜像非常简单,以下是具体的步骤:

1. 获取镜像地址

清华大学开源软件镜像站点提供的GitHub镜像地址为:

2. 配置Git

如果你使用Git进行版本控制,可以将清华镜像作为默认的远程地址。以下是配置方法:

bash

cd your-repo-directory

git remote set-url origin https://mirrors.tuna.tsinghua.edu.cn/git/github/your-repo.git

3. 使用镜像进行克隆

当你需要克隆一个GitHub项目时,可以使用以下命令:

bash git clone https://mirrors.tuna.tsinghua.edu.cn/git/github/your-repo.git

4. 定期同步

如果你已经有了本地仓库,并希望将其与GitHub上的仓库同步,你可以使用以下命令:

bash git pull origin master

GitHub清华镜像的注意事项

  • 数据更新频率:清华镜像的数据更新并不是实时的,可能存在延迟。
  • 特定项目的可用性:并非所有GitHub上的项目都能在清华镜像上找到,具体情况需查阅镜像站点。

常见问题解答(FAQ)

Q1: GitHub清华镜像的速度真的比直接访问GitHub快吗?

是的,对于中国大陆的用户,使用清华镜像通常会显著提高下载速度。由于清华镜像位于国内,网络延迟更低,下载速度更快。

Q2: 如何确保我使用的是最新的代码?

因为清华镜像更新频率不一,建议在使用前查看项目的更新状态。如果需要最新代码,还是建议直接访问GitHub进行查看。

Q3: 如果我遇到下载失败,应该怎么办?

可以尝试更换网络环境,或检查你的镜像地址是否输入正确。同时,可以查看清华镜像的官方网站,确认是否出现了系统维护或故障。

Q4: 清华镜像是否支持所有的GitHub功能?

清华镜像主要用于代码的下载和克隆,对于其他GitHub的功能如issue、pull request等,并不提供支持。用户需访问GitHub官网进行相关操作。

总结

通过使用GitHub清华镜像,用户可以有效地提升在中国大陆访问GitHub的速度,减少因网络原因导致的烦恼。掌握清华镜像的使用方法,将有助于开发者更加高效地管理项目。希望本文能够帮助你更好地使用GitHub资源。

正文完